Understanding the complexities of a credit card statement

A credit card statement is a vital financial document that offers a thorough summary of your spending habits and supports you in managing your finances effectively. The important details found on a credit card statement typically include:

  • Transaction history: A thorough log of all purchases, costs, and payments.
  • Past balance: The sum that was carried over from the prior billing period.
  • Payments: The total of all money paid.
  • New purchases: The total amount spent on recent acquisitions.
  • Interest charges: The costs associated with keeping a balance.
  • Current balance: The total amount owed.
  • Minimum payment due: The least amount needed to cover costs and avoid penalties.
  • Deadline: The time by which the minimum payment must be made.

What should you check in your credit card statement?

Maintaining financial stability and spotting possible fraud require routinely reviewing your credit card statement. There are essential components that you must check and dare not miss out on reading and reviewing for safety reasons.

Start by scanning basic details like

  • Date of statement and billing cycle: Recognize the time frame for which the statement is valid.
  • Deadline: Make sure you pay on time to avoid late fines and a lowered credit score.
  • Grace period: Pay off the entire balance during the grace period to maximize interest-free credit.
  • Transaction details: Verify all transaction details, including the date, amount, and name of the merchant.
  • Total amount due: Recognize the total amount due as well as your available payment choices.
  • Minimum payment: Take note of the required minimum payment amount, but try to pay more to lower interest costs.
  • Credit limit: Keep an eye on your available credit to make sure you don’t go over.
  • Cash advances: Examine any cash advances you’ve received, keeping in mind that they frequently come with higher fees and interest rates.
  • Points for rewards: Keep track of your points and look into possible redemptions.

A thorough examination of your credit card statement would uncover

  • Unauthorized charges: Identify any unfamiliar transactions that may indicate fraudulent activity.
  • Foreign transaction fees: Verify accuracy if you’ve made international purchases.
  • Interest charges: Understand how interest is calculated and ensure it aligns with your expectations.
  • Fees and charges: Check for unexpected fees, such as annual fees, late fees, or over-limit fees.
  • EMI conversions: Ensure you comprehend the terms and interest rates of any converted EMIs.
  • Credit utilization: Monitor your credit utilization ratio to maintain a healthy credit score.
  • Customer service messages: Review any communications from the credit card company.

Important considerations for credit cardholders

Before reviewing your credit card statement, bear the following points in mind:

  • Hold onto physical statements: Maintain well-organized records for later use.
  • Turn on internet alerts: Get alerts when there are low balances or suspicious activity.
  • Quickly correct errors: If you notice any discrepancies, get in touch with your credit card company right away to dispute them.

By closely examining your credit card statement, you can identify possible problems, reduce your risk of fraud, and make wise financial decisions. Consequently, you can:

  • Identify unauthorized charges: Quickly pinpoint any transactions that seem off.
  • Identify spending patterns: Keep an eye on your spending patterns and make any necessary adjustments by analyzing your spending trends.
  • Effectively manage debt: Make sure that payments are made on time to prevent accruing excessive debt.
  • Maximize rewards: Make the most of your credit card’s benefits and rewards.

You can avoid stress, save money, and save time by setting aside a short period once a month to review your statement. It's a preventative step to keep peace of mind and financial control.
